Job Summary

The Credit Assistant is responsible for receiving all applications from Sales Support Assistants in accordance with established cut-off time, and initial review and processing of loan applications in line with the Banks standards and requirements.



Key Responsibilities

 

  • Ensures that loan requirements are complete and reviewed prior loan approval.

  • Responsible for ensuring loan requirements are complete prior to loan release/booking.

  • Responsible for tasks such as but not limited to scheduling of loan releases, filing and warehousing applications and documents, organizing loan folders, encoding of necessary data and results into the loans system/s, and the like.

  • Provides regular MIS, reports and forms according to standard process.

  • Assists the Credit Officer in activities required in the processing, checking, evaluating, and maintaining of loans.
